What was the name of Noah's father?
a. Methuselahb. Shemc. Lamechd. Adam
1
"[Lamech] became the father of a son. He named him Noah..." Genesis 5:28-29
What were the names of Noah's three sons?
a. Shem, Ham, and Jephethb. Moe, Larry, and Curlyc. Shadrach, Meshach, and Abednegod. Abraham, Isaac, and Jacob
2
"Noah became the father of three sons: Shem, Ham, and Japheth." Genesis 6:10. See also Genesis 5:32.
What did God instruct Noah to build?
a. a large tower, reaching to the skyb. a stone wallc. an ark, or ship
3
"God said to Noah... Make a ship of gopher wood." Genesis 6:13-14. Some versions use the word "ark" or "boat" instead of "ship."
How many levels did God instruct Noah to build in the ark?
a. fiveb. threec. tend. two
4
"You shall make it with lower, second, and third levels." Genesis 6:16
How did Noah respond to Yahweh's instructions?
a. He completely disobeyed Yahwehb. He only partially obeyed Yahweh's
instructionsc. He did everything that Yahweh
commanded him
5
"Noah did everything that Yahweh commanded him." Genesis 7:5. See also Genesis 6:22
How old was Noah when the flood of waters came on the earth?
a. five hundred yearsb. six hundred yearsc. six hundred and one yearsd. thirty seven years
6
"Noah was six hundred years old when the flood of waters came on the earth." Genesis 7:6
How many days and nights did it rain during the flood?
a. fortyb. sevenc. twenty eightd. one hundred
7
"It rained on the earth forty days and forty nights." Genesis 7:12
How many days did the waters flood the earth?
a. forty nineb. seventyc. one hundred fiftyd. two hundred
8
"The waters flooded the earth one hundred fifty days." Genesis 7:24
After the flood, what did Yahweh tell Noah and his sons that they could eat?
a. every moving thing that livesb. only green herbsc. every fruit and vegetable, but no meatd. any vegetable and any meat, but no
fruit
9
"Every moving thing that lives will be food for you. As I gave you the green herb, I have given everything to you." Genesis 9:3
What did God establish as a sign of his covenant with Noah and his family, and all living things on earth, to never again destroy the earth by flood?
a. an ox headb. a golden ringc. the rainbowd. the ark
10
"I set my rainbow in the cloud, and it will be a sign of a covenant between me and the earth." Genesis 9:13
After the flood, what did Noah plant?
a. a vineyardb. an olive grovec. a wheat fieldd. an apple orchard
11
"Noah began to be a farmer, and planted a vineyard." Genesis 9:20
How many years did Noah live?
a. 87b. 500c. 600d. *950
12
"All the days of Noah were nine hundred fifty years, and then he died." Genesis 9:29
